In 2024, industrial facilities in Spicewood, TX released over 0.26 lbs of pollutants. The primary source was ASPHALT INC. SPICEWOOD, which emitted Polycyclic aromatic compounds into the local air. Air quality in 78669 is relatively consistent with regional baselines.
